It is crucial to first comprehend the importance of Hawaiian names. In Hawaiian culture, names serve as more than just labels; they also serve as symbols of spirituality, ancestry, and self-expression. They are frequently a reflection of nature, family, or personal characteristics and are given with significant thought and deliberation. As a result, misusing a Hawaiian name or failing to show adequate respect might be considered as both rude and insensitive.

Moreover, it is important to consider how a Hawaiian name is used as well as whether it is used at all. An example of cultural appropriation and disrespect would be utilizing a Hawaiian name as a trendy brand name or marketing ploy. The purpose and context of using a Hawaiian name must be taken into account.

Regarding the subject of why Hawaiians have Spanish last names, Hawaii’s history of colonization and immigration is the reason behind this. Hawaii was a center for the sugar business in the late 19th century, and many plantation owners hired labor from several nations, including Spain. These employees frequently got married to Hawaiian natives, which led to the adoption of Spanish last names.
